Customers now reach for items
To add just a little bit of life to the world, customers will now reach for items when purchasing them. The item will also fly towards them similar to how items bought from NPC's will fly towards the player.

Change Log
Additions
- Thief Zapper MK II added, purchase it from Chris for 50,000 Muns
- Thief Zapper MK II Fuse added, each fuse allows 1 zap and can be ordered through the scroll and added to the fuse holder in the management house
- Fast Travel points added to the Farm, Town and Harbour. More points will be added as development progresses
- A trash can is now available to be purchased and placed in your shoppe. This is available next to the management house. Customers will throw trash into the trash can rather than on the floor. However if it is full, the trash will be thrown on the floor instead
- RGB Color sliders for Eye color
- RGB Color sliders for Hair color
- Ability to choose your character's order chest
- Customers can now be seen reaching for items they are steeling
- Items fly towards the customer once bought or stolen
- Additional customer damage sounds added
- Additional female voice added to customers
- Mercenary now displays how long he will take to finish his current hunt
- Kick button added to player tabs for the server
- Sir Poshington offers you to redeem ALL decorations from the shoppe at once if you have badly placed decorations from previous save files.
- Shoppe reputation tip video added
- Alchemist received an idle animation
- Blacksmith received an idle animation
- Item levels revealed in description panels
- Character customisation displays how many items you have unlocked through chests
Changes
- Placing items on displays grants Business skill points
- Max display count has now been increased to 300
- Furniture placement warning sound now has a greater cooldown
- Updated decoration placement
- Teleportation to the furniture vendor removed as it was not intended
- Max mercenary hunt count is capped at 500
- Damaging furniture will no longer increase combat XP
- Combat XP earned now depends on your weapon damage
- Updated item info UI when aiming at a display spot
- Base cost of an item is now displayed in the item price list in town management
- Grinder speed slowed down dramatically
- Dropped items have buoyancy in water
- Consumable event will only affect consumables on displays rather than the entire display
- When a player crafts the same thing it will get stacked into the same order, the amount gets stacked
- Crafting 2+ items at the same time decreases crafting time by 25%
- Changing from Inventory/Order/Skills while Scroll is open, wont close the scroll
- Ember drops doubled
- Health potion buffed
- Bow charging has more points of charge
- Crosshair is now turned off when interacting with containers
- You can close the shoppe reputation window with the same button as you use to open it - 'L'
